Get your DVRs ready. Radio and talk show host/author Tavis Smiley is moderating a new conversation. Here’s our conversation about his latest project. After a decade of his “State of the Black Union” events, Smiley has branched out for a discussion that will be somewhat different from the annual grouping of panels broadcast to discuss the pressing issues of black America. (In this 2009 photo, Tavis Smiley talks about his book, "Accountable: Making America As Good As Its Promise." (Retna) )
This time, Smiley has put together a multi-racial roster that includes Arianna Huffington of The Huffington Post, CNBC’s Maria Bartiromo, Dana Milbank of The Washington Post and Smiley’s friend and co-host Dr. Cornel West, among others, to facilitate a conversation on America’s future. Smiley celebrates 20 years of broadcasting this year (look for an upcoming PBS anniversary special) and is releasing a new book, “Fail Up,” an account of how he rebounded from his 20 greatest failures, in May. Keep up with him at his website, www.TavisTalks.com.
Aptly dubbed “America’s Next Chapter,” the two-hour special airs live from George Washington University on C-SPAN on Thursday, Jan. 13 from 6 to 9 p.m. EST and again on PBS from Tuesday, Jan. 18 to Thursday, Jan. 20 (If you are in the Washington D.C. area, you can attend for free by registering at www.americasnextchapter.com ).
